The facilities in and around Exeter make it one of the best locations for flight training in the country! Exeter itself is well equipped with an I.L.S. D.M.E. approach to both ends of the main 26/08 runway. There is also an N.D.B. D.M.E. approach on runways 26 & 08. Students who train with us benefit from an excellent training aid in the form of the EX (echo X-ray) which is located 4 miles off the airfield. Another benefit of the airfield is its location to the N864 airway, saving time during training and tests given its location directly above the airport.
There is the Yeovill MATS North East of the airfield again giving our student an excellent opportunity to learn and interact with various aircraft types and both civilian and military controllers. There are four airfields used for various instrument procedures within a short flight from Exeter, they are Cardiff, Bristol, Yeovil and Plymouth. If two students are paired together, there is also an opportunity to go to the Channel Island with one student flying the outbound, and the other the return leg.
The airport is not as busy commercially as most of its neighbors so very little time is lost waiting for departures or training slot times but there is enough commercial traffic for the student to gain an insight into "slot times" as well as expedient planning and handling of a flight.
Testing for all ratings are conducted onsite again saving both time and money. The school is well serviced with both staff examiners from Bournemouth as well as local area CPL Examiners who have always been very accommodating for our students.
